The second goal of an analysis evaluation in a woman with SUI is to analyze the differential medical diagnosis of urinary incontinence and assess the impact of existing side-by-side conditions. The differential diagnosis of SUI includes various other reasons for urethral incontinence, such as overflow incontinence (a scientific diagnosis) and detrusor overactivity incontinence, reduced bladder conformity, and stress-induced detrusor overactivity (urodynamic diagnoses). Various other anatomic findings such as pelvic body organ prolapse and number and area of ureteral orifices can be diagnosed by checkup and cystoscopy, specifically. Similarly, added useful problems, such as urethral blockage and impaired or lacking contractility, can be determined by means of urodynamics testing, consisting of cystometry, non-invasive uroflow, pressure-flow study, and PVR assessment.

At the time of follow-up, the subjective end result of surgical procedure as regarded by the person needs to be analyzed and recorded. Information pertaining to resolution of SUI, need for pads and number made use of, presence or lack of OAB signs, ease of voiding/force of the urinary stream along with other pertinent reduced urinary system tract signs need to be evoked. New onset medical site or pelvic pain and dyspareunia must additionally be clearly inquired. Gadget infection is rather uncommon, with prices in long-term series varying from much less than 1% up to 5%.145, 225 It is a significant presentation with discomfort at the site of the AUS; high temperature; scrotal warmth or erythema; or skin adjustments and demands an immediate explantation of the tool. An AUS must not be changed in the setup of infection for a minimum of three months to permit the infection to clear and swelling to diminish. Cuff erosion can be due to unrecognized urethral injury at the time of preliminary surgical procedure or most likely due to subsequent instrumentation of the urethra consisting of catheterization.
